Concise Encyclopedia of Mexico includes approximately 250 articles on the people and topics most relevant to students seeking information about Mexico. Although the Concise version is a unique single-volume source of information on the entire sweep of Mexican history-pre-colonial, colonial, and moderns-it will emphasize events that affecting Mexico today, event students most need to understand.
Reviews'This concise edition of the groundbreaking Encyclopedia of Mexico - successfully retains the strengths of the original work in a convenient format aimed at a more general audience.' CHOICE
